如何根据对模型所做的更改自动更新视图?

时间:2013-08-29 15:13:11

标签: c# asp.net-mvc

例如,当添加新控制器并指定模板(具有使用实体框架的读/写操作和视图的MVC控制器)和模型类时,MVC可以完成魔术并创建与控制器中的每个操作相对应的视图,视图可能包括表单和数据详细信息。

接下来,我使用新属性更新模型类:

public string Location { get; set; }  

然后,相应地更新数据库。

现在,我希望此更改也会反映在控制器的视图中;例如,创建视图表单中的新位置标签和文本框等等

这可能,还是必须手动完成?如果对模型进行大量更改,这可能会有很多工作。

1 个答案:

答案 0 :(得分:1)

我不认为这是可能的。您在控制器和视图中执行的所有操作均符合您的规范。我不认为ASP有能力思考你想要的东西以及你想要的东西。